The Chronic Pulmonary Hypertension (CPH) treatment market, valued at $6,494.7 million in 2025, is projected to experience robust growth, driven by a rising prevalence of CPH, advancements in therapeutic interventions, and an expanding geriatric population. The market's Compound Annual Growth Rate (CAGR) of 5.1% from 2025 to 2033 indicates a steady increase in demand for effective treatments. Key growth drivers include the development of novel targeted therapies, improved diagnostic capabilities leading to earlier detection and treatment, and increased awareness among healthcare professionals and patients regarding the disease. The oral route of administration currently dominates the market, reflecting patient preference for convenience and ease of use. However, intravenous/subcutaneous and inhalational therapies are gaining traction due to their efficacy in severe cases. The hospital pharmacy segment holds a significant market share, primarily due to the complex nature of CPH management requiring specialized healthcare settings. However, retail and online pharmacies are also witnessing increased involvement, mirroring wider healthcare trends towards greater patient access and convenience. Geographic distribution shows North America and Europe as leading markets, driven by higher healthcare expenditure and advanced healthcare infrastructure. However, Asia-Pacific is predicted to witness substantial growth, spurred by rising disposable incomes, improving healthcare access, and a growing understanding of CPH. Competitive dynamics are shaped by the presence of established pharmaceutical giants alongside innovative biotech companies constantly developing new treatment modalities.
The market's growth trajectory is influenced by several factors. While increased awareness and treatment options contribute positively, challenges remain. High treatment costs can limit accessibility, particularly in low- and middle-income countries. Moreover, the complexity of CPH and its varied presentations necessitate personalized treatment approaches, leading to ongoing research and development efforts to improve efficacy and safety. Regulatory hurdles and the time-consuming process of drug approvals can also impact market penetration of new therapies. Future growth hinges on successful clinical trials, continued innovation in drug delivery systems, and the development of more cost-effective treatment strategies to improve patient access and outcomes. Several factors are propelling the growth of the chronic pulmonary hypertension (CPH) treatment market. The rising prevalence of CPH globally is a primary driver, fueled by aging populations, increasing rates of associated conditions like heart failure and lung diseases, and improved diagnostic capabilities leading to earlier detection. Advancements in treatment modalities, including novel targeted therapies, are significantly impacting market expansion. These newer drugs offer improved efficacy, better safety profiles, and enhanced patient tolerability compared to older treatment options. The increasing investment in research and development by pharmaceutical companies is further driving innovation in this sector, resulting in a pipeline of promising new drugs that are currently under development. Growing awareness and improved understanding of CPH among both healthcare professionals and patients are also contributing factors, leading to increased diagnosis and treatment rates. Furthermore, supportive government initiatives and regulatory approvals are facilitating market growth by enabling wider access to new and existing therapies. Finally, the increasing healthcare expenditure in developed and developing countries is creating a favorable environment for the market's expansion. This combined effect of increased prevalence, technological advancements, and improved access significantly contributes to the market's robust growth trajectory.
Despite the significant growth potential, the CPH treatment market faces several challenges and restraints. The high cost of treatment is a major barrier, making access difficult for many patients, particularly in low- and middle-income countries. The complexity of the disease and its varied presentations pose challenges in diagnosis and treatment selection, leading to potential delays in initiating appropriate therapy. Moreover, the potential for severe side effects associated with some treatments can limit their use and adherence. The lengthy and expensive drug development processes involved in bringing novel therapies to market present significant hurdles for pharmaceutical companies. Regulatory hurdles and stringent approval processes can delay the launch of new drugs, impacting market growth. The need for improved diagnostic tools for early detection and better prognostic indicators remains a significant challenge. The lack of awareness about CPH in many regions, coupled with limited access to specialized healthcare facilities, further restricts early intervention and comprehensive management. Competition among existing and emerging pharmaceutical companies is intense, necessitating continuous innovation and cost-effective strategies to maintain a competitive edge. These challenges underscore the need for collaborative efforts between researchers, healthcare providers, and policymakers to improve access to effective and affordable CPH treatment.
